Supplements Every Triathlete Should Consider
Triathletes face unique nutritional challenges due to their demanding training regimen. One critical aspect is ensuring adequate energy levels during workouts and competitions. Supplements can help fill nutritional gaps, but it is essential to choose wisely. The right supplements can enhance performance, speed recovery, and ensure optimal hydration. Therefore, triathletes should consider several supplements to support their training goals. A well-rounded supplement regimen includes protein powders, electrolytes, and omega-3 fatty acids. Protein powders help rebuild muscle post-training, while electrolytes replace fluids lost through sweat, preventing dehydration. Omega-3 fatty acids can reduce inflammation and support joint health. To maximize benefits, select high-quality products with natural ingredients. Always consult a registered dietitian or sports nutritionist before starting any supplement, as individual needs may vary based on factors such as age, weight, and overall health. Doing so ensures that athletes receive tailored advice suited for their specific circumstances, optimizing performance and health. With the right approach, supplements can be valuable tools in a triathlete’s nutrition strategy, helping to balance energy demands and recovery needs.
Among the most popular supplements for triathletes is branched-chain amino acids (BCAAs). These essential amino acids are crucial for muscle recovery and growth during demanding training periods. BCAAs help reduce muscle soreness and fatigue, allowing athletes to maintain high training volumes. Many triathletes opt for BCAAs as pre-workout, intra-workout, or post-workout supplements to maximize their effectiveness. Besides muscle recovery, BCAA supplementation may enhance endurance, making workouts seem less strenuous. Try to integrate BCAAs into your routine by considering options like capsules or flavored powders that mix easily with water. It’s vital to experiment with these products during training instead of competition to gauge individual responses. Another supplement worth considering is beta-alanine, known for boosting performance during high-intensity exercises. By increasing carnosine levels in muscles, beta-alanine can help delay fatigue and enhance overall endurance. Seek out reputable brands that offer pure beta-alanine products without fillers. Staying hydrated and maintaining a balanced diet remain fundamental to triathlon success and should complement any supplement use.
Importance of Electrolytes
Electrolytes are pivotal for triathletes, especially during long training sessions or races. They help maintain hydration and optimal muscle function, which is critical in endurance sports. Key electrolytes include sodium, potassium, magnesium, and calcium, all of which can be lost through sweat. Proper electrolyte balance is vital for preventing cramping, fatigue, and heat-related illnesses during triathlons. Most athletes can benefit from incorporating electrolyte supplements into their hydration strategy. They come in various forms, including powder, tablets, and drinks. Choose products that suit individual tastes and requirements, ensuring they are free from artificial ingredients or excessive sugars. While water is essential, relying solely on it may not be sufficient during prolonged efforts. This is because water alone does not replenish electrolyte levels effectively. Look for options that provide a balanced mix of essential electrolytes to support endurance performance. Combine these supplements with a well-structured hydration plan, adjusting fluid intake based on weather conditions and exercise intensity. Remember that electrolyte needs vary individually, so paying attention to bodily signals is vital.
Another supplement to consider is creatine, which has gained popularity for its performance-enhancing benefits in various sports. Creatine is known to improve strength, endurance, and recovery between high-intensity efforts. By boosting adenosine triphosphate (ATP) production, creatine provides additional energy during short bursts of intense exercise. While typically associated with strength training, it can also benefit triathletes when integrated thoughtfully. To incorporate creatine into a triathlete’s routine, consider a loading phase followed by a maintenance dosage. However, always ensure proper hydration while using creatine, as it may increase water retention in muscles. Moreover, while some may experience digestive discomfort, dosage adjustments can help alleviate this issue. Another supplement option is a multivitamin formulated for athletes, providing essential minerals and vitamins that can often be overlooked in day-to-day nutrition. These can aid overall health and support immune function, especially during heavy training cycles when the risk of illness may increase. Always choose a multivitamin specifically designed for active individuals, ensuring it meets daily nutritional needs.
The Role of Omega-3 Fatty Acids
Omega-3 fatty acids are essential for overall health, particularly for triathletes as they promote joint health and reduce inflammation. These fatty acids can enhance recovery times, allowing athletes to bounce back quicker from intense workouts. Triathletes often experience joint strain due to the repetitive nature of their training activities. Adding omega-3 supplements, like fish oil or algae-based capsules, can help alleviate discomfort by providing anti-inflammatory effects. Including a high-quality omega-3 supplement may also improve cardiovascular health, which is crucial for endurance athletes. Aim for supplements that contain both EPA and DHA, two primary types of omega-3s that work synergistically for enhanced benefits. To maximize these fatty acids’ effects, incorporate them alongside a balanced diet rich in whole foods like fruits, vegetables, and whole grains. Be conscious of potential interactions between omega-3 supplements and blood thinners, consulting with a healthcare provider for personalized advice. Pairing omega-3 supplementation with regular exercise can further promote joint and muscle health, enhancing athletic performance in triathlons.
Another key component for triathlete nutrition is Vitamin D, which plays a crucial role in bone health and immune function. Exposure to sunlight is the primary source of Vitamin D, but athletes often struggle to get enough, especially in colder climates. Supplementation may be necessary for those who find themselves deficient. Research has shown that Vitamin D supports muscle function, strength, and recovery, making it vital for active individuals. When selecting a Vitamin D supplement, look for a product that provides Vitamin D3, which is the most effective form for raising blood levels. Additionally, consider checking Vitamin D levels through a simple blood test, providing guidance on appropriate dosing. Pairing Vitamin D with magnesium and calcium can further support bone health, which is essential for high-impact sports like triathlon. While supplements are beneficial, aim to complement them with food sources such as fatty fish, fortified dairy, and legumes. Proper nutrition is foundational for long-term athletic performance, making comprehensive dietary strategies crucial for success in triathlons.
